> Jens K. Becker wrote:
> > Hi all,
> >
> > I am puzzling over this problem for quite some time now and just
> cant
> > find a solution... I have a set of polyhedra that share facets and
> > vertices. Obviously, each facet can only belong to two polyhedra
> while a
> > vertex might belong to much more. If I want to delete a facet (or
> a
> > vertex) or add a facet (or a vertex) to one polyhedron, I have to
> add
> > the same to other polyhedra too. The most convenient would be to
> > construct a (Delaunay) triangulation of the part of the polyhedra
> where
> > things are going to happen, do whatever has to be done and
> reconstruct
> > the polyhedra from that triangulation. But how? The problem is the
> > reconstruction because I cannot think of any way how to decide
> which
> > facet of the triangulation belongs to which polyhedron. Is there
> an easy
> > way to do this? Or a hard way?
> >
> > The triangulation would typically consist of 20-30 vertices only,
> I can
> > store which vertex belongs to which polyhedron in the vertices
> and/or I
> > could store which facet belongs to which polyhedron (before
> > inserting/deleting things from the triangulation) but I did not
> figure
> > out a way how to reconstruct it from this information.
> >
> > I tried to have a look at the example in CGAL3.4 that does
> remeshing of
> > a polyhedron, but did not really understand what is happening
> there (and
> > could not get it to compile neither, but that's another story).

> Hello,
> I think maybe the meshes you need to deal with are like this
> one (from SIGGRAPH 2000 Course Notes Subdivision for Modeling
> and Animation) if I have not misunderstood the situation you
> illustrated.
>
> To mark the facets to which mesh they belongs, maybe you can
> redefine some basic structure like the demo
> "examples/Polyhedron/polyhedron_prog_color.cpp" or in PDF
> manual page 1523, it redefined the half-edge structure to add
> a color component.
